Method of Working Volatile Hydrates for Artificial Refrigeration. (open access)

Method of Working Volatile Hydrates for Artificial Refrigeration.

Patent for a new and improved method of working volatile hydrates for refrigeration. This invention "consists in the continuous circulation through a chamber to be refrigerated of aqueous solution of volatile matter previously cooled by the expansive elimination therefrom of a portion of said volatile matter" (lines 64-68).

Method of Converting Mesquite Beans. (open access)

Method of Converting Mesquite Beans.

Patent for a new and improved method of treating mesquite beans. This is a design "whereby they are converted into a healthful easily-digestible article of food . . . or may be infused in liquid for producing a healthful or agreeable drink" (lines 8-13). It consists, "first, in a preliminary drying of the bean as a whole to eradicate moisture; second, breaking the thus-dried bean into short pieces to render it more readily affected by the heat . . . third, roasting the broken particles to render friable or more brittle; fourth, grinding the mass, and fifth, separating the powdered bean and outer pod from the hull" (lines 13-21).
